The Mackie ProFX12v3+ is a 12-channel professional analog mixer and USB-C audio interface designed for high-resolution 24-bit/192kHz recording and streaming. Featuring premium Onyx preamps, switchable USB recording modes, bidirectional Bluetooth with Mix Minus, and an intuitive color LCD for customizable GigFX+ effects, itโs the ultimate compact solution for home studios and live events seeking studio-quality sound with wireless convenience.

Well built, cristal clear audio, no hiss or hum, and that clean icy EQ that Mackie is known for. Love it! Well built and works well in a multi-track recording setup as the audio interface. Make sure and use the Mackie driver. The mixer will use the Windows native driver just fine but the native driver will not allow access to USB channels 3 and 4. Without the Mackie driver you can not listen to playback and record new tracks without the old tracks rerecording on top of the new tracks.

Solid inexpensive mixer
24/192 The audio output is good. Listening to various audio tracks and comparing it to DACs/AMP's I own, it keeps up. I've tested a couple of the tracks and the faders, buttons, and knobs work as expected. Once I downloaded and installed the USB Drivers, the USB-C interface worked flawlessly. Compressor was mentioned by another user, it does work, just extremely subtle in its effect, to the point it is worthless. I've tested out the other effects and they work. For input, I tried the SM7B with a CloudLifter. It does introduce noise but its not overwhelming. I haven't tried using the SM7B without the cloud, but I'll update once I give it a chance. Right now I'm just getting it setup. Power cable was a bit short for my needs, not the end of the world but I had to get creative during the setup for this initial review. Like I said earlier, I also needed to download the USB-C drivers from Mackie's website, so its not exactly plug & play with Windows 10. Not a deal breaker again, just part of the setup process. This, compared to my old 8 Channel mixer, is leagues better. A lot has changed and it seems like the music industry is really catering to pod casters and streamers, making it fairly simple to setup one of these devices to your computer. Right now I am happy. I'll continue testing and exploring and updating the review as I discover more. Thanks for your time, hope this helped. Update 8/27/2025: I was able to use both the included recording software (Waveform13) and Reaper with this. My first impressions with Waveform were not great. That could be my fault though since its a bit different than Reaper. I'll give it a more fair shot and learn the work flow they're trying. Till then, all I can say is both applications work. I also used the bluetooth to take a couple of phone calls just for fun and the wife wasn't amused. It works though. Finally used the SM7B without the Cloudlifter and its better without. The Gain and Fader will be near max, but it introducing way less noise.
